Abstract :
One of the most investigated heat transfer fluid or heat storage medium in the field of thermal solar conversion is the ‘‘solar salt”, a
mixture of nitrates NaNO3/KNO3, 60/40% by weight, respectively. The content of potassium in this fluid allows exploiting the self activity
of the isotope 40K to perform measurements useful for control or diagnostics of a solar plant. Here an experimental test on the noninvasive
measurement of the salt level in a tank by means of gamma-ray spectrometry is shown.
